DFU 219L is a 1972 MG Midget in Red with a 1,275c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.8%.

Across all 1972 MG Midget models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.5% with a typical mileage of 33,792 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a MG Midget f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 2,648 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DFU 219L,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The MG Midget typically stays on UK roads for around 63 years. At 54 years old, this MG Midget is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
